1.3 General product information
Models range from 1000mm to 2000mm in length, in both Standard and High capacity and are available in either Electrically heated, Ambient or LPHW. They are designed for discreet positioning in a suspended ceiling or bulkhead in the doorways of retail or commercial premises. Optional case for doorways with restricted space and no suspended ceiling/ bulkhead are available.

1.4 Model Denitions
 ACR1000xxxx = ACR Airbloc 1M in length. 1200=1.2M;
1500=1.5M; 1800=1.8M; 2000=2.0M. ACRxxxSxxx = ACR Airbloc Standard Capacity (up to 3M
from oor); H=High Capacity(up to 4m from oor) ACRxxxxExx = ACR Airbloc Electrically heated.
A=Ambient; W=LPHW coils. ACRxxxx12 = ACR Airbloc 12kW coils. 6=6kW; 9=9kW;
12=12kW; 18kW.
-1ph sux = ACR Airbloc 230V Single phase supply (Std format =3pha)
-SM sux = ACR Airbloc SmartElec Energy Saving Controller (Std format=Standard AC/ACR Control)
e.g. ACR2000HE18-SM = ACR Airbloc Air Curtain, 2M long, 18kW electrically heated high capacity c/w SmartElec Control.

1.9 Clearance distances
It is recommended that a minimum clearance of 100mm is allowed around the case. The clearance allows for cable entry and prevents combustible surfaces overheating.
The minimum mounting height (oor to grille) is 1.8m. The recommended maximum mounting height is 3m for standard and 4m for high capacity models.
1.10 Electrical Supply
For full electrical loadings, please refer to the individual technical data sheets within this manual.
It is recommended that the electrical supply to the base unit in the air curtain is via an appropriate switched isolator in accordance with the regulations in force in the country of use and must be via a fused isolator having a contact separation of greater than 3mm in all poles.
Electrically heated supply is 415V 3 phase, neutral and earth. Max cable inlet size is 10mm².
